What Are Business Simulation Games?

Business simulation games are designed to offer players a taste of management, entrepreneurship, or corporate strategy within a virtual environment. Players often handle resources, design strategies, and navigate various challenges to grow their in-game businesses or empires. This sub-genre of simulation games blends elements of strategy and role-playing, allowing for immersive experiences that keep players engaged.

Notable Business Simulation Games

Some of the standout titles that have shaped the genre include:

Game Title Release Year Key Features
SimCity 1989 City-building, resource management
The Sims 2000 Life simulation, relationship-building
RollerCoaster Tycoon 1999 Theme park management, design elements
Football Manager 1992 Sports management simulation

Business Simulation Games vs. Traditional Games

Unlike many traditional games that center on combat and adventure, business simulation games typically focus on strategic planning and decision-making. Let's explore some distinctive features:

  • Strategy Over Action: Business simulation games prioritize planning and economic management instead of reflexes or combat skills.
  • Long-term Engagement: They often encourage players to invest time in growing their businesses rather than completing short-term objectives.
  • Complex Gameplay Mechanics: The decision-making process can include a variety of elements from finance to personnel management.
